Normal Operation and Fault Conditions

The Belt Tension Sensor (BTS) operates in conjunction with the OCS. The OCS interprets a variable voltage signal provided by the Belt Tension Sensor (BTS) to identify the possible presence of a child safety seat in the front passenger seat. The voltage output of the Belt Tension Sensor (BTS) is proportional to the amount of tension applied to the sensor by the belt: no belt tension causes a low voltage (approximately 0.95 volt) to be output and high belt tension causes a high voltage (approximately 3.8 volts) to be returned to the OCSM.
The OCSM monitors the Belt Tension Sensor (BTS) and related circuits for the following faults:
- Resistance out of range
- Unexpected voltage
- Short to ground
- Faulted Belt Tension Sensor (BTS) (part of right front passenger seatbelt buckle)
PPT AX OCSM DTC FAULT TRIGGER CONDITIONS
| DTC | Description | Fault Trigger Conditions |
|---|---|---|
| B0061:11 | Passenger Seatbelt Tension Sensor: Circuit Short to Ground | Sets when the OCSM measures voltage below a predetermined threshold from the Belt Tension Sensor (BTS) signal circuit. An open Belt Tension Sensor (BTS) VREF circuit can also set this DTC. |
| B0061:12 | Passenger Seatbelt Tension Sensor: Circuit Short to Battery | Sets when the OCSM measures voltage above a predetermined threshold from the Belt Tension Sensor (BTS) signal circuit. An open Belt Tension Sensor (BTS) return circuit can also set this DTC. |
| B0061:13 | Passenger Seatbelt Tension Sensor: Circuit Open | Sets when the OCSM senses an open from the Belt Tension Sensor (BTS) circuit. |
| B0061:64 | Passenger Seatbelt Tension Sensor: Signal Plausibility Failure | Sets when the passenger seatbelt is unbuckled and the OCSM measures voltage from the Belt Tension Sensor (BTS) signal circuit greater than the maximum voltage returned during normal sensor operation. |
